Every application needs to notify users — a new message arrived, a task was completed, a payment failed, an invitation is waiting. Sending these notifications reliably across email, SMS, push, and in-app channels without building and maintaining a separate integration for each provider is a significant engineering challenge. Novu solves this with a unified notification infrastructure — one API that routes notifications to the right channel for each user, with templates managed centrally, provider switching without code changes, and an open-source codebase that can be self-hosted for complete data control.

Novu is a notification infrastructure platform — an open-source layer that sits between an application and the notification providers it uses (Sendgrid for email, Twilio for SMS, Firebase for push, and others), providing a unified API for triggering notifications, a workflow engine for defining multi-step notification sequences, and a template management system that separates notification content from application code.
Its provider abstraction means that switching from SendGrid to Resend for email, or from Twilio to Vonage for SMS, requires a configuration change in Novu rather than a code change in the application — eliminating provider lock-in and making provider switching a deployment rather than a development task.

Yes, Novu’s cloud plan is free for up to 30,000 notification events per month. The self-hosted open-source version is free with unlimited events at your own infrastructure cost.
Direct provider integrations require separate code for each provider and make switching providers a development task. Novu provides a single integration point, workflow management, template control, and provider switching through configuration — reducing engineering overhead and eliminating provider lock-in.
Yes, Novu includes AI content generation tools for drafting notification copy — email subjects, SMS messages, push notification text — from brief descriptions of the notification’s purpose and audience.
Yes, Novu is fully open-source under the MIT licence and can be self-hosted on any infrastructure — providing complete data control for organisations with compliance or data residency requirements.
Novu provides a pre-built React component for an in-app notification centre — a notification feed with unread count and mark-as-read functionality — that can be embedded directly into a product without building the notification UI from scratch.
